Established 1680, the Old Burying Ground, or Old Graveyard, was the site of the notorious grave robberies of 1818. Of the 2000 plus residents interred in this burial ground, the stones of around 375 are still standing today, including those of prominent reverends and many Revolutionary War soldiers.

Park somewhere along Main Street, and duck into the cemetery through the gap in the wall. Pass by the Old Hearse House on your left. Most of the stones in the center and to the right (facing the cemetery) are 19th century stones. To the left are the older 18th (slate) and 17th century (schist) stones. You're going to venture towards the back of the cemetery, but take your time and meander a bit, observing the carvings on these ancient gravestones. Make sure to seek out the table tomb for Rev. John Wise during your explorations.

To find The Chosen One letterbox, you'll need to head to the back left corner of the cemetery. Search for the connected trio of gravestones for Anna, Caroline, and Abner Burnham (photo shared on AtlasQuest link). Standing in front of these gravestones, look to your left to see a long piece of granite in the grass, laying parallel to the stone wall at the back of the cemetery. Standing on the pointy tip on the right end of this piece of granite, facing towards the back of the cemetery, look directly ahead to the tree standing just behind the stone wall. Clamber over that wall (be very careful not to disturb the stones of this old wall! We climbed over a lower spot several paces to the right, just past the large split stone). Buffy: The Chosen One is nestled in a crevice in the wall beside this tree. Please rehide just as well as, if not better than, you found it.
